Sydney sat in the small camp that had been established for the night. The sound of crackling fire filled the night along with the cries from the night beasts.

She had changed out of her upneck shirt and now, everyone could see that sate of her neck, besides, it was too hot that she was forced to give herself a breather now that it was night.

Here. The food is ready." Shawn said passing her a small bowl of rice, cabbage and meat.

Thanks." Sydney took it and begun to munch on the food in thought. They had followed the trail and she believed Titan would be found in a short while but that hadn’t been the case.

Shawn left and soon returned with a soaked piece of fur then used it to wipe at her neck. He didn’t say much knowing she was still angry with them even after a number of days had gone by.

You have to rest early so we can leave on time tomorrow." Ken spoke from the side. The words he could exchange with her had lessened and no matter how he tried to provoke her, she’d just completely ignore him. It was different and difficult to bare!

Ray returned from the patrol with more firewood and added a few pieces into the fire making it light up more. This would naturally attract the attention of other beasts but they were no worried at all!

After her meal, Sydney walked into her small tent and went to sleep not even saying a goodnight to them.

Their moods were extremely bitter.

Late into the night, Sydney groaned and turned in her sleep distressed, the mark once again begun to burn and it was painfully hot, unfortunately, she couldn’t wake up and kept twisting and turning.

At the first sound of her distressed cry, Caden and the others had run into the small tent making it stuffy.

They could see that the mark on Sydney’s neck was moving chaotically!

This was the first time they saw something like this.

Females had mate markings but never would those marks make any movement, they were perturbed on how to deal with this.

What’s going on?" Ken asked in fear. The whole of her neck seemed like it was on fire as it turned red to a scary degree. Even the heat that her body was emitting was like she was dipped into a furnace!

Shawn rushed out and came back with a small pail of water to help her cool down. What the heck are you doing?!" Ray reprimanded as he slapped away the basin that it tumbled spilling all its contents. "You can’t use water to cool down such a fire! She’d get more sick!"

I didn’t know that! How are we going to help her?" He asked worry etched in his dual coloured eyes.

We can only wait." He said and all hearts sunk. Sydney twisted and turned through our the whole night and by the time morning came, she had calmed down but was badly exhausted that she didn’t wake up. It was like it was only at that time that she got to rest.

Her mates’had dark under eyes from worry. They now knew how if felt like to be helpless!

She’s seems a whole lot better now!" Caden who was the closest pointed out and the others were also happy to see that it was the case.

I’ll go and hunt something. She should he hungry after going through this night." Ken said and ran off to find fine prey.

Ray who couldn’t stand watching during the night had gone out to inspect the area and pick fights to cool himself down. He lay on the ground after battling a group of wild wolves who scurried off upon realising that they couldn’t beat him even when he was in his own.

Despite being wounded, he could still make out someone approaching him. He didn’t have the energy to be vigilant since that other party didn’t seem to have any I’ll intent towards him.

That was some pent up energy." Lilly spoke gently as she looked down at Ray with a brooding look.

Haha...it’s you. Did you enjoy the show?" He asked helplessly. He was too focused on beating someone up that he completely ignored the possibility of this girl’s presence.

He scanned around the area but there was no sign of the triplets. He huffed but was too lazy to question her.

I did. Too bad you weren’t beaten to my satisfaction." She said heartlessly and Ray almost spat out a mouthful of blood.

Lilly folded her hands over her chest and continued to observe his facial expressions.

This girl! Seriously! If she wasn’t his mate’s child, he’d spank her till she called him father!

What are you here for?" He asked ignoring her remarks.

I’m here to see mother." Her reply was on point. It was only for her mother that these people got to look at her. She hoped that soon, she’d be strong enough to take her mother away from this place and from them!

"How did you know she had left the city?" He asked trying to get himself to sit up but it was useless as it seemed like he had a few dislocated bones and all that stuff. He gave up and lay there.

"With such unreliable men, of course I’m bound to come and ensure constant check ins on mother." She didn’t give a damn about their egos and jabbed at them.

"Do you know that we are your elders! How can you speak to me like that!? If your father knew you had grown up like this, how bad would his heart hurt?! Hmm?" Ray felt bitter.

Lilly was silent for a while before she stood up and looked down at him. "A few friends of mine should come and pay you a visit. The time without us has made you grow gutsy!" Her tone was cold and her eyes held no trace of deear for this guy.

Ray rolled his eyes but knew he did not have much time to waste here. He needed to move before he was turned into meat paste. "Why are you so ruthless to me!? He cried out pushing himself up ignoring the burning pain in his body. What was he to do when he felt his mates’ link to him break at that time! It was natural that he’d loose himself! But he had done his best, hadn’t he!?

I’m not ruthless. I just don’t really like you " Lilly said and walked to the side to calmly watch the impending show.

Ray looked at the pair of innocent but heartless eyes looking back at him. He really never understood where her anger rooted from. They had already done their best to see that alot could change, they had given up their own beasts to tamper with time and it had been successful but that also didn’t seem to calm her mind at all. She felt that were undeserving of her mother! He sighed.

But not long, the sound of animals charging his way reached his ears and he wasn’t so lucky. He tried to move but because he lacked his beast, his healing abilities had dwindled by alot! He hadn’t fully recovered!

A wolf that was hiding in the bushes sat calmly but the sudden charging herd startled his target scaring it off. He was so angry that he jumped out to give chase anyway only to find himself being dragged into trouble.

The herd of wilder beasts charged at him and his prey. Seriously! Ken sneered and ran off at a leisurely pace. He didn’t really take them seriously but some one had to compensate for startling his hunt.

However as he ran forward, he caught on a familiar scent mixed with blood and increased his pace to go and check out what was going on.

Huh!" He skidded to a halt tumbling and tripping over a stone before he crashed rolling into the ground before stopping just besides Ray.

The whole thing happened animatedly that Lilly who was on the side did not know how to feel. What was with her mother finding unreliable men! It was truly embarrassing. She looked away but her eyes were filled with laughter. Silly!

Ken on the other hand was a completely different case! Why was there a small Sydney here!?

His legs were pointing into the sky as he hadn’t recovered from his earlier shock! He blinked once, twice, thrice but the small figure was still there which affirmed that he wasn’t hallucinating at all! It was real!!

However, the impending herd didn’t stop it’s attack just because he fell down!

Lilly wanted the herd to stamp them to death! So embarrassing!

But Ken wasn’t one to die so easily. He saw Ray’s state and dug his teeth into his arm before dragging him to the side evading the herd by a mere breathe.

However, Ken still had eyes on Lilly who was looking at him coldly.

Except for the eyes which were a pitch black, she was the exact copy of Sydney! Who are you!? He wanted to ask but bit back his words. He felt this small figure was way too cold for him to dare her.

I’ll come back another time." She opened her close fist and threw a blue herb to Ray. "Give that to mother. She’ll be better after she eats it." She said and turned to leave since her work here was done.

Ray looked at the blue herb and sighed. He had spent that whole night looking for it but since it was rare, he knew finding it wouldn’t have been an easy fit which made him extremely frustrated ending up in him fighting a pack of wolves.

Thank you Lilly." Ray murmured seeing her departing figure. Even though she was cruel to him and the others, at least she treated their mate quite nicely. These superficial wounds were nothing to him in comparison to Sydney’s well being.

After leaving their sight, Lilly walked over and the herd which seemed crazed earlier on stood waiting for her with clear eyes and anticipation. "Let’s go." She said and got onto the king of the herd before they went off running at a steady speed.
